Lead kernel software initiatives and enhance performance alongside a supportive team. This mid-level engineer position is primarily remote and focuses on Linux kernel development using multiple programming languages.As a Linux Kernel Software Engineer, you will be pivotal in implementing and maintaining kernel features for high-performance systems. Your duties include evaluating new CPUs for support integration and leading projects from planning through deployment. Collaborating with junior engineers and hardware development teams will ensure the highest software quality and debugging efficiency.Key Responsibilities:• Develop and support new Linux Kernel features• Evaluate and integrate CPU hardware support• Mentor junior engineers on software practices• Collaborate with customers to resolve technical issues• Maintain engagement with kernel community for contributionsRequirements:• 3+ years of direct Linux kernel experience• Extensive C programming knowledge, plus C++ and Python• Proficient in troubleshooting and Linux kernel design• Familiarity with upstream development processes• Strong ability to document and communicate designs clearlyYour role will significantly impact software quality and kernel advancements in a fast-evolving tech environment.#J-18808-Ljbffr
Linux Kernel Software Engineer With Mentorship Responsibilities
ARISTA NETWORKS
vancouver, vancouver
Published 27 days ago
Report job